Every company, large or small, has a wealth of valuable data to help make impactful decisions. However, extracting insights typically requires significant manual effort on the raw data, either by semi-technical users (such as founders or product leaders) or by dedicated (and expensive) data specialists.

Either way, to create real value, you need to collect, manage, modify, and extract information from dozens of spreadsheets and various business platforms (including your organization’s CRM, martech stack, e-commerce system, and website data, to name a few common examples). Obviously, this is a time-consuming process, and the result may be old news rather than the latest insights.

Introduction of vibe analysis

The ideal business solution would use smart systems running in the background to query real-time data using natural language (rather than writing code in SQL or Python), correlating and parsing different data sources and formats. This is atmospheric analysis, where users can simply ask questions in plain language and let the AI ​​do the heavy lifting. Instead of spending hours manually wrestling with data and uncovering insights hidden deep within datasets, business users can get results quickly with text, graphics, summaries, and optionally detailed breakdowns.

Fast and accurate data analysis is important for any organization, but for many, real-time insights are key. For example, in the agriculture sector, Lumo uses Fabi.ai’s platform to manage IoT devices at scale, continuously collect telemetry data, and adjust systems based on collated, normalized, and parsed information.

Lumo uses vibe analysis to instantly see not only your device’s performance, but trends that develop over time. Capture weather data and correlate device fleet performance metrics with environmental factors. The data dashboards Lumo builds are the result of atmospheric analysis, not months of work creating data integration routines and front-end coding.

get under the hood

Skeptics of AI’s capabilities often point to vibecoding as an example of where things can go wrong, raising concerns about quality control and the “black box” nature of AI-driven analytics. Many users want visibility into how results are produced, with options to inspect the logic, fine-tune queries, and adjust API calls to ensure accuracy. When done well, vibe analysis can address these concerns by combining transparency and rigor. Natural language input and modular construction methods make it accessible to semi-technical users (such as founders and product leaders), and the underlying system meets standards of accuracy and reliability expected by technical teams. This means users can trust the output whether they are working alone or collaborating with data scientists and developers.

Fabi is a generative BI platform designed specifically for both data professionals and semi-technical data users to enable vibe analysis. The generated code can be completely hidden or viewed and edited on the fly, giving semi-technical users the opportunity to understand how the analysis works under the hood, while allowing technical teams to validate and fine-tune the system’s output. Data either flows from an organization’s systems (the platform brokers the connection) or is uploaded. The resulting actionable insights can be pushed/scheduled to email, Slack, Google Sheets, or displayed as graphics, text, or a combination of both.

Fabi: A generative BI platform

Fabi co-founder and CEO Marc Dupuis explains how many organizations start using analytics platforms by testing workflows and queries on sample data before moving on to actual analysis. As users delve into the treasure trove of data and test their work, thanks to the platform’s Smartbook open and transparent view of what’s going on under the hood, users can often collaborate with someone more technically savvy to check the veracity of the data. It also works the other way around. Users of semi-technical data can ensure that the data they are processing is relevant and accurate.

To address common concerns about quality control and “black box” AI, Fabi uses built-in guardrails to limit vibe analysis to internally controlled and carefully accessed data sources. The ability to view code as is and edit it on the fly allows semi-technical users to visualize how results are generated, while technical teams can audit, validate, and fine-tune output. By collaborating and sharing reports, findings, and actionable code, teams can validate results without working outside their areas of expertise.

Common workflows include real-time KPI dashboards. Natural language Q&A on operational and product data. Correlation analysis (e.g. device performance against weather conditions). Studying cohorts and trends. A/B test results and experiment summary. Scheduled, shareable reports that combine text, graphics, summaries, and detailed breakdowns. These collaborative workflows are designed to be efficient and intuitive, so users can extract insights from even the most complex data arrangements, whether working together or alone.

Fabi received its first backing from Eniac Ventures in 2023 and is a company on the move. The team plans to continue expanding the functionality and making vibe analysis even more seamless for both semi-technical and technical users. Organizations interested in exploring the platform can start by testing their workflows with sample data and scale up to real-world use cases once they are confident in the system’s transparency and accuracy.
